Answered unrecognised number (which I don't usually do, but have friends in Caloundra so thought I'd better check) - it was from 'charity survey', it said "representing some of the largest charities in Australia". It sounded like a recorded message; when I said it sounded like a robot, there was a pause and it said, gee I'm sorry to hear that. It paused if it detected me say something, then continued with the set spiel. Hung up, and blocked.
